
将网站添加到云服务器上是一个技术活,但只要遵循一些步骤,就能轻松完成。本文将为您详细介绍如何将网站部署到云服务器上。以下是这一过程的几个关键步骤,我们将逐一探讨:
1. **选择云服务提供商**
2. **购买云服务器**
3. **配置服务器(Linux/Windows)**
4. **部署网站**
5. **域名解析**
6. **测试与维护**
### 第一部分:选择云服务提供商
在中国市场,有许多云服务提供商可供选择,以下是几个较为知名的:
– **阿里云**:提供多种规格的云服务器,价格合理。
– **腾讯云**:提供灵活的选项和较好的支持。
– **百度云**:适合大数据和机器学习的应用。
– **西部数码**:国内知名的云服务商,服务稳定。
#### 选择的标准
– **性能**:选择适合您网站流量的配置。
– **价格**:根据预算选择合适的方案。
– **支持**:选择有良好技术支持的服务商。
– **地理位置**:选择离您目标用户较近的数据中心,以提高访问速度。
### 第二部分:购买云服务器
一旦选择了服务提供商,您可以按照以下步骤购买云服务器:
1. **注册账号**:访问云服务提供商官网,注册一个账号。
2. **选择产品**:进入云服务器(ECS)页面,按照您的需求选择配置(CPU、内存、存储等)。
3. **选择镜像**:选择操作系统镜像(Linux或Windows),常用的Linux版本有Ubuntu、CentOS等,而Windows Server也是一个常见选择。
4. **设置安全组**:配置防火墙规则,开启必要的端口(例如80端口用于HTTP,443端口用于HTTPS)。
5. **确认订单**:确认购买清单,完成付款。
### 第三部分:配置服务器(Linux/Windows)
#### 1. 连接到云服务器
– **Linux**:使用SSH连接,您可以使用命令行工具(如终端、PuTTY):
  “`
  ssh root@你的云服务器IP
  “`
– **Windows**:使用远程桌面连接,输入您的云服务器IP和用户名/密码。
#### 2. 更新服务器
连接后,更新软件包以确保服务器是最新的:
– **Linux**:
  “`
  sudo apt update
  sudo apt upgrade
  “`
– **Windows**:可以通过“Windows Update”进行更新。
### 第四部分:部署网站
部署网站的步骤主要涉及安装Web服务器和上传网站文件。
#### 1. 安装Web服务器
– **Apache**(常用Linux服务器):
  “`
  sudo apt install apache2
  “`
– **Nginx**(高性能服务器):
  “`
  sudo apt install nginx
  “`
– **IIS**(Windows):
  – 通过“服务器管理器”添加角色和功能,选择“Web服务器(IIS)”即可。
#### 2. 上传网站文件
可以通过SFTP(如FileZilla工具)或命令行(如scp)将网站文件上传到云服务器的指定目录。
– **Linux**(默认Web目录在`/var/www/html`):
  “`
  sudo cp -r /本地文件路径/* /var/www/html/
  “`
– **Windows**(默认Web目录在`C:\\inetpub\\wwwroot`):
  – 将文件复制到该目录下。
#### 3. 修改配置文件(可选)
根据需要,您可能要修改Web服务器的配置文件:
– **Apache**:通常在`/etc/apache2/sites-available/000-default.conf`中配置。
– **Nginx**:在`/etc/nginx/sites-available/default`中配置。
– **IIS**:使用IIS管理工具可以轻松进行各种配置。
#### 4. 启动Web服务器
– **Linux**:
  “`
  sudo systemctl start apache2  # 如果使用Apache
  sudo systemctl start nginx     # 如果使用Nginx
  “`
– **Windows**:在IIS管理工具中启动服务。
### 第五部分:域名解析
将购买的域名解析到云服务器的IP地址上:
1. 登录域名注册商的管理后台。
2. 找到DNS管理页面。
3. 将A记录的主机名指向您的云服务器IP。
例如:
– 主机名:`@`(代表根域名)
– 记录类型:`A`
– 点对点:您的云服务器IP地址
#### 验证DNS配置
使用`nslookup`命令或在线工具检查域名是否解析正确。
### 第六部分:测试与维护
#### 1. 测试网站
– 打开浏览器,输入您的域名,查看网站是否可以正常访问。
– 检查各个链接和功能是否正常。
#### 2. 维护与监控
– 定期更新服务器软件。
– 配置监控工具(如Zabbix、Prometheus)监控服务器状态。
– 备份网站文件和数据库,以防丢失。
### 结语
将网站添加到云服务器并没有想象中那么复杂,通过以上步骤,您可以轻松地将自己的网站部署到云端。选择合适的云服务提供商,合理配置云服务器,以及定期进行维护,可以确保您的网站在云服务器上稳稳运行。如有进一步的问题,随时欢迎咨询!
以上就是小编关于“怎么把网站添加到云服务器上”的分享和介绍
西部数码(west.cn)是经工信部、ICANN、CNNIC认证的全球顶级域名注册服务机构,是中国五星级域名注册商!有超过2000万个域名通过西部数码注册并管理,超过100万个网站托管在西部数码云服务器和虚拟主机。西部数码支持数十个顶级域名的注册与管理,支持批量查询、批量注册、批量解析、智能解析、批量过户等便捷好用的功能,拥有非常好的使用体验。
目前,西部数码域名注册正在特价,最低仅需1元!
更多详情请见:https://www.west.cn/services/domain/
西部数码域名抢注预定,支持抢注各类高价值老域名,支持“建站历史、百度收录、百度权重、历史外链、百度评价、搜狗反链”等数十项综合检索功能!!可快速精准定位到您想要定位到的各类精品域名!同时,西部数码域名抢注集成了全球多个抢注商(近200个抢注商,还将陆续增加),整理出10多条抢注通道,从根本上提升了抢注成功率!
其中,1号通道,实测抢注成功率高达99% 。每天西部数码预释放功能还会释放若干优质过期域名,可以直接抢注竞拍。
赶紧预订抢注心仪的优质域名吧:https://www.west.cn/booking/


